If a Tree Doesn’t Fall in the Woods, Does Starlink Work?
Chippokes State Park, VA, May 2026 Starlink requires open sky overhead in order to function. Here at Chippokes, the sky looks like this. That is pretty much the definition of “not open sky”. Starlink refers to this as “Partially Obstructed”, but it looks “Mostly Obstructed” to me. There is a gap in the trees to…

F350 vs F450
Background When we bought our F350, the sales person guaranteed that we would have at least a 3,600 lb cargo capacity. He said it should be closer to 4,000 lbs. We were not talking to some random Ford car salesperson; we were talking to one of the commercial truck sales people. You would expect them…
